MLB Delays Opening Day to Mid-May at Earliest Due to Virus

NEW YORK (AP) – Major League Baseball has pushed back an opening day until mid-May at the earliest because of the coronavirus. The move came Monday after the federal government recommended restricting events of more than 50 people for the next eight weeks. Baseball Commissioner Rob Manfred made the announcement following a conference call with executives of the 30 teams….

March Madness: Conferences Scrap Tourneys; NCAAs in Doubt

The Move Puts an Abrupt End to the Season

(AP) – The NCAA has canceled its men’s and women’s basketball tournaments because of the spread of coronavirus. The move puts an abrupt end to the season less than a month before champions were to be crowned. Morris Claims State Title

'The Hope of the Hillside' Stopped McLaurin to Claim Jr. Welterweight Crown

Duluth is home to a brand new state boxing champion.  Saturday night at Throw Down at the Bear at Black Bear Casino, ‘The Hope of the Hillside’ Markus ‘Hooch’ Morris claimed the vacant Minnesota Jr. Welterweight Championship by knocking out Jeremy McLaurin in the 7th round.
